JUDGE 2:

Remix 1:
========
Creativity: 4/10
Overall Sound: 6/10
Melody 2/10
Arrangement 2/10

This remix starts with some nice elements, a xilophone which sounds very caribbean.
It also starts with a snare, which turns out to be the main kick. I appreacite the idea of wanting to do something unique, but uniqueness does not always mean that is good, and in this case that snappy sound all over the track, just don't work.
The lovely melody of the original was torn off in this one, with a careless interpretation with no emotion or concept.
Its overall sound is clean enough, but that is thanks to its minimal nature, and that extremely minimal attempt is what killed this remix.
The arrangement, well, it is not only Dj Unfriendly, but there are no signs of the three main parts of a trance song or any type of music genre for that matter. What I hear is only an intro track op 6 minutes long.

Overall: A very poor attempt to remix a classic.

Average Score: 3.5/10



Remix 2:
========
Creativity: 6/10
Overall Sound: 8/10
Melody: 6/10
Arrangement: 8/10

This Psy-Trance intro mix has the very characteristocal elements of a good Psy Trancer, plenty of sick acid and 303 lines.
There is also a good dose of variation to keep you motivated to listen further.
The intro, although not very epic, would work quite well as the opening of a set.
It is not very creative compared to other Psy Trance tracks, but the fact that this is a full traslation from Melodic trance to Psy makes it deserving a good score in this area.
The overall sound is top notch, I think we are dealing with an d\advanced producer here, I just would have liked to hear those open hats with lower volume.
Melody again, this is a full traslation from Melodic Trance to Psy Trance, the subtleness that made this track a classic was taken away to replace it for a savage interpretation, which for this kind of genre works but if I was a purist trancer, I would have told him, what did the melody did to you to deserve such punishment.

Arrangement: It is pretty good, it is an intro track which the Djs could use to open a set, there is a breakdown, there is a build up which lacks of tension and an outtro. All elements are there.

Overall: A good psy trance remix perfect for psy fans.

Average Score: 7/10



Remix 3:
========
Creativity: 6/10
Overall Sound 6/10
Melody 8/10
Arrangement 4/10

What's with the moaning? I understand that using Vocal Dlips could enhance a track, but here.. is not the case, simply because they distract rather than enhance the listeners experience, that is why instead of adding up to his creativity value, they give this track a minus.


Its overall sound, lets say it is a good draft, but we are not judging engineers but producers, so it passes the test, the some leads sound a little too dry, the gating pad could use more reverb if it was a supportive melody to put it in the background, but he used it as his main lead, so it is cool.
There is plenty of emotion here if you ignore the moaning (if that is possible), the gating pad-lead, the chords and the sweeping melody work quite well together melodic wise. I love that fat side chained pumping bassline.

The arrangement

There is a big minus here in my opinion, the intro part had started nicely, and then at 57 seconds, this producer introduces the breakdown! Full of moaning and featuring what the main melodies are going to be in the next.... 5 minutes!
It means that I'll have to listen to the same melodies being looped for 5 long minutes, when I wasn't even starting to get tired of the intro part. Yes there is a breakbeat part build by the same kickdrum and same snare, and analog bassline, is not enough. The outtro part is full of annoying moaning, if he thought this was sexy maybe he should of tried mixing singing vocals with less of this with good dose of delays and reverb to make it dreamy at least, to make them blend not stand out more than the main melodies.

Overall: A progressive Trance remix more influenced by porno than by its original predecessor, well crafted in some areas, and totally wasted in others.

Average Score: 6/10



Remix 4:
========
Creativity 10/10
Overall Sound 6/10
Melody 4/10
Arrangement 5/10

Tech Trance banger! it starts with an awesome set of percussion and hard kickdrum making it very groovie and energetic, it was a very nice start until those intro leads with excessive volume on them were introduced.
Honestly, this track would have been a lot better without them, specially they are brought in again in the climax to play ON TOP (rather than in the background as support) of the main leads. Instead of these I would have put some nice pads, Sound FX and enhanced the tremendous experience of that groove that this remixer had going on here.
As arrangement, well, when the intro track went silent for a moment, I thought of giving it a minus for that for not letting it flow, but then the "Boom!" vocal gave that nice touch to take off from where it left seconds ago.

Then by the 1:04 minute mark, the kick is taken off, to let the intro lead play for a moment, here is where a good built up should have taken place and drop the energetic drums keep playing, but instead, he/she built down, that is a mistake there, you want to keep flowing, you want to create more tension and build adrenaline in tracks like this until the breakdown is faded in.

The breakdown was disappointing really, here is where this track should have exploded into an emotional tech blizzard, not only that the build up didn't create enough tension for what was to come, so those incredible drums didn't sound as espectacular as they would have sound with a well crafted build up.
The climax was so so, the main leads where overshadowed by the intro lead, it should have been the other way around.
I enjoyed the outtro a lot, gives a lot to rave to, if it wasn't for that spectacular first minute and the last two minutes, this would have deserved nothing but a 1.

The main melodies could have used a moment of spark, if he opened those filter cut offs of the main leads in the breakdown, they could have used a moment of glory.

Overall: A very creative mix sacrificing, arrangement and melody values, but if you ask me if there was a godd techno trance producer in the way to the top of the mountain, I would point you in his direction, he is not ready yet, but he has a promising future.

Average Score: 6.2/10
